What is an AI Generator?
An AI generator is a sophisticated software application that uses artificial intelligence, specifically machine learning models, to produce various forms of content autonomously. These tools are trained on vast datasets of existing information, allowing them to learn patterns, styles, and structures across different mediums. When given a specific prompt or input, the AI processes this information and generates original content that aligns with the user’s request. This can range from generating natural-sounding text to creating unique images, synthesizing audio, or even writing lines of code, all based on the learned parameters from its training data. The core functionality relies on complex algorithms that predict and assemble new outputs based on statistical likelihoods derived from the training corpus.
- Natural Language Processing (NLP)
Natural Language Processing is a branch of AI that focuses on enabling computers to understand, interpret, and generate human language. For text-based AI generators, NLP is the foundational technology that allows them to comprehend user prompts, analyze existing text, and produce coherent and contextually relevant responses. It involves a suite of techniques, including tokenization (breaking text into words), parsing (understanding grammatical structure), and semantic analysis (interpreting meaning). Advanced NLP models can even discern sentiment and tone, allowing AI generators to craft content that resonates emotionally with readers. This capability is crucial for generating human-like conversation, summarization, translation, and text creation.
- Machine Learning Models
Machine Learning models are the engines behind AI generators, allowing them to learn from data without being explicitly programmed for every specific task. These models, often neural networks, are trained on massive datasets – for example, billions of words for text generators or millions of images for art generators. During training, the model identifies patterns, relationships, and statistical regularities within the data. When a user provides a prompt, the model uses its learned understanding to predict the most probable sequence of words, pixels, or code segments that fulfill the request. Generative Adversarial Networks (GANs) and Transformer models (like those behind GPT) are particularly prominent in the field of content generation, excelling at creating novel outputs. This iterative learning process is what allows the AI to produce outputs that often surprise users with their creativity and coherence.
Types of AI Generators
AI generators have diversified significantly, moving beyond just text to encompass a wide array of creative disciplines. Understanding these different types helps users identify the best tool for their specific needs, whether they are a writer, artist, developer, or marketer. Each type leverages AI in unique ways to transform various inputs into distinct, meaningful outputs. This section outlines the most prevalent categories of AI generators you’ll encounter today.
- Text-based AI (GPT Models)
Text-based AI generators, popularized by models like OpenAI’s GPT (Generative Pre-trained Transformer) series, specialize in producing written content. These tools can generate articles, emails, social media posts, stories, code, and even poetry from a simple prompt. They excel at understanding context, maintaining tone, and expanding upon ideas, making them invaluable for overcoming writer’s block or drafting large volumes of text quickly. Their ability to produce coherent and contextually relevant paragraphs stems from their training on vast internet datasets, enabling them to mimic human writing styles and patterns. Users often leverage these AI generators to accelerate content production, assist with research by summarizing information, or brainstorm new ideas for creative projects. They are particularly useful for marketing copy, blog outlines, and even drafting entire articles, provided human oversight refines the output.
- Image-based AI (Stable Diffusion, DALL-E)
Image-based AI generators, such as Stable Diffusion and DALL-E, translate textual descriptions into visual art. Users provide a text prompt detailing their desired image, and the AI generates unique pictures, illustrations, or photo-realistic scenes based on that input. These tools are revolutionizing digital art, graphic design, and marketing by offering a rapid way to create custom visuals without requiring advanced drawing skills or expensive stock photo subscriptions. The underlying technology often involves diffusion models or GANs that learn to create images by iteratively refining a noisy input based on the text prompt. This allows for unparalleled creative freedom, enabling the generation of anything from fantastical landscapes to product mockups, significantly reducing the time and effort traditionally associated with visual content creation. Many artists use these AI generators as a starting point for their creations, blending AI output with their own artistic touch.
- Code-based AI (Copilot)
Code-based AI generators, epitomized by tools like GitHub Copilot, assist software developers by generating code snippets, functions, or even entire algorithms based on natural language comments or existing code. These tools are trained on massive repositories of public code, allowing them to understand programming patterns, syntax, and common solutions. By predicting the next lines of code, they accelerate development, reduce boilerplate, and help developers avoid common errors. This type of AI generator acts as an intelligent pair programmer, suggesting code in real-time within integrated development environments (IDEs). It significantly boosts developer productivity, helping to automate repetitive coding tasks and allowing engineers to focus on more complex problem-solving. While not a replacement for human programmers, code-based AI tools are powerful assistants for improving efficiency and ensuring code quality.

Crafting Effective Prompts
The quality of output from an AI generator is often directly proportional to the quality of the input prompt. Learning to craft effective prompts is a crucial skill for anyone looking to maximize the potential of these tools. A well-designed prompt acts as a clear set of instructions, guiding the AI to produce content that is precise, relevant, and aligned with your specific objectives. It’s about communicating your intent clearly to the machine.
- Be Specific and Detailed
When interacting with an AI generator, specificity is paramount. Instead of a vague prompt like “write a blog post,” try “write a 500-word blog post for small business owners on the benefits of integrating CRM software, focusing on improved customer relationships and sales efficiency, using a professional but encouraging tone.” The more details you provide regarding the topic, target audience, desired length, tone, keywords, and specific points to cover, the better the AI can tailor its output to your needs. Including examples or preferred formats can also guide the AI toward a more satisfactory result. Think of the AI as a very intelligent but literal assistant; it can only work with the information you explicitly provide. A detailed prompt minimizes ambiguity and reduces the need for extensive revisions, ensuring the AI generator delivers content closer to your vision on the first attempt.
- Experiment and Iterate
Prompt engineering is an iterative process. It’s rare to get perfect results on the first try, especially for complex requests. Experimenting with different phrasings, keywords, and structural elements within your prompts is essential. If the initial output isn’t quite right, analyze what went wrong and adjust your prompt accordingly. For example, if the tone is too formal, explicitly request a more conversational style. If it missed a key point, add that detail to your next prompt. Don’t be afraid to try multiple variations of a prompt or to break down a large request into smaller, more manageable sub-prompts. This iterative refinement process helps you understand how the AI generator interprets different instructions and allows you to gradually guide it towards the desired outcome. Continuous experimentation also helps unlock new creative possibilities you might not have initially considered.
Ethical Considerations for AI Generated Content
The proliferation of AI generators brings with it a host of ethical responsibilities that users and developers must address. As AI becomes more sophisticated, understanding and mitigating potential negative impacts becomes increasingly important. Ethical use ensures that these powerful tools serve humanity beneficially, rather than creating new problems related to integrity, fairness, and truth. Responsible deployment is key to maintaining trust and promoting positive societal outcomes.
- Plagiarism and Originality Checks
While AI generators are designed to produce novel content, there’s always a risk of unintentional similarity to existing works, especially if the AI was trained on a specific dataset or if the prompt is very common. Therefore, it is an ethical imperative for users to perform thorough plagiarism and originality checks on all AI-generated content before publishing or presenting it as their own. Tools like Turnitin or Copyscape can help identify similarities. Relying solely on AI without verification can lead to academic misconduct, copyright infringement, or reputational damage. The AI generator should be seen as a collaborator, not a replacement for due diligence. Ensuring originality is not just about avoiding legal issues; it’s about maintaining integrity and providing genuine value to your audience. This human responsibility remains central to ethical content creation.
- Bias and Misinformation
AI models are trained on vast datasets, and if these datasets contain biases (e.g., gender, racial, cultural stereotypes) or inaccurate information, the AI generator can inadvertently perpetuate or amplify them in its output. This can lead to biased content, stereotypes, or even the spread of misinformation. Users must critically evaluate AI-generated content for fairness, accuracy, and neutrality. It’s crucial to understand that AI doesn’t “know” truth; it only predicts patterns based on its training data. Therefore, human review is essential to identify and correct any biases or factual errors before dissemination. Companies developing AI generators also have a responsibility to address bias in their training data and model design. Active vigilance against these issues is necessary to ensure AI-generated content is responsible, equitable, and contributes positively to public discourse, preventing the AI generator from inadvertently causing harm.

- Data Handling Policies
Before committing to an AI generator, thoroughly review its data handling policies and terms of service. Understand what data is collected (e.g., your prompts, generated content, usage metrics), how it’s stored, and who has access to it. Some AI services may use your prompts or generated content to further train their models, which could potentially expose sensitive information or proprietary ideas if not carefully managed. Look for services that offer robust data encryption, secure servers, and clear commitments to not share or use your data without explicit consent. For businesses, compliance with regulations like GDPR or CCPA is non-negotiable. A transparent data handling policy ensures you know exactly how your intellectual property and personal information are being treated, allowing you to use the AI generator with confidence. Prioritizing providers with strong privacy safeguards helps mitigate risks associated with data breaches or misuse, ensuring your information remains confidential and secure.
- User Control Features
Beyond passive policies, look for AI generators that offer active user control features over your data. This might include options to delete your prompt history, opt-out of data being used for model training, or manage content permissions. Some platforms provide granular control over what information is retained and for how long. The ability to purge sensitive data or control access to your generated outputs provides an extra layer of security and ensures compliance with personal or corporate privacy mandates. Strong user control features empower you to dictate the lifecycle of your data within the AI generator’s ecosystem, reducing reliance on the provider’s general policies alone. This proactive approach to data management fosters a safer and more trustworthy AI experience, giving you peace of mind that your creative work and information are protected. It’s about having the power to manage your digital footprint effectively.
